Need a New Heat Pump in Opelika, AL? These 3 Signs Say Yes

February 28, 2022

How do you know whether your heat pump in Opelika, AL, should be replaced? There are a few common signs that suggest you should start talking to your HVAC professional about an upgrade. Read on to learn more about these heat pump symptoms and what they mean.

Extremely High Bills

Let’s say you’ve seen a spike in your energy bills. If you know you’ve been using the heat pump more than usual, that would explain it. Otherwise, some component in your system is failing or needs replacement.

You shouldn’t have to deal with a breakdown two or three times a year. If this has been happening to your heat pump, then a replacement will save you money in the long run.

Constant Running and Lukewarm Air

Sometimes, a constantly running heat pump could just result from a clogged air filter. Other times, it constantly runs simply because of cold outside temperatures. But if you notice the system running continuously and yet never reaches the desired temperature, the time may have come for a new system.

Another possibility is that your heat pump doesn’t have the capacity to heat your home anymore. This is most common if you change the size of your home without adding additional HVAC capabilities. Talk to a professional about your current home needs and see if they recommend something different than you have.

Continual, Disturbing Noises

Outside of some noise when the heat pump cycles on and off, you shouldn’t hear anything. Grinding, banging, and squealing would definitely point to the need for a repair or possibly a new system altogether.

Heat pumps last about 10 to 15 years; if yours has reached that stage and displayed some of the above characteristics, then consider a replacement.
